Изменения

Перейти к: навигация, поиск

API модуля мобильных устройств

1234 байта добавлено, 18:46, 21 июля 2015
Создание/изменение курьеров
== Создание/изменение курьеров ==
Запрос отправляется по адресу https://home.courierexe.ru/api/clientapi.php
 
<source lang="xml">
<?xml version="1.0" encoding="UTF-8"?>
<upload>
<auth guidlogin="234232a045345311e397603012323423423login" pass="pass" />
<table>kurier</table>
<item>
</item>
</upload>
</source>
 
Запрос содержит тег upload - загрузка на сервер. auth - авторизация по login и pass. table - имя таблицы.
Далее следуют один или несколько контейнеров item, каждый содержит 1 запись для добавления или изменения на сервере.
 
Описание полей:
code - int, идентификатор записи. Если запись с таким code уже есть - она будет заменена.
name - ФИО курьера
phonem - телефон курьера. Используется для обратного звонка при интеграции с телефонией.
dateput - дата увольнения, чтобы блокировать курьера. Если курьер работает - NULL, если уволен - укажите дату увольнения в формате YYYY-MM-DD
 
В случае успеха запроса сервер вернет:
<source lang="xml">
<?xml version="1.0" encoding="UTF-8"?>
<upload error="0">OK</upload>
</source>

Навигация